LG LX260 or LG Slider Messaging Mobile Phone gets an FCC Approval

LG gets an approval from FCC for its new cell phone, dubbed LX260 or LG Slider Messaging.

LG LX260 Slider phone LG has collaborated with Sprint, American mobile operator to launch the latest mobile device. However, the company has not yet finalized the name of the handset. As of now, there are two options available, namely LG Slider Messaging and LG LX260.

The stylish slider handset features QWERTY keyboard, Bluetooth connectivity, a camera, and a microSD memory slot. It also comes equipped with 1.3 megapixel camera, pre-loaded software for e-mail and instant messaging and supports stereo, MP3. It is also compatible with CDMA 1xRTT networks.

LG is planning to release the LX260 or LG Slider Messaging in the coming few months through Sprint in two colors. Price is yet unknown.
